ECOJEWEL is the first eco-sustainable jewelry. It is produced in Italy with the highest respect for mankind and the environment, using precious, recycled materials (gold and silver from existing jewelry and manufacturing scraps) and ecogems (synthetic products from Switzerland with the same physical and chemical characteristics as the natural stones). Recycled paper is used for the exhibition layouts, communications materials and packaging.

All ECOJEWEL activities are Zero Impact and have Lifegate certification. We compensate our energy consumption with reforestation programs in Italy (Parco del Ticino) and Costa Rica.
Impatto Zero® measures the environmental impact of activities, companies, products and people by calculating carbon dioxide and greenhouse gas emissions. It helps reduce and compensate CO2 emissions by creating and safeguarding new forests in Italy and throughout the world. Universities and Partners specialized in Life Cycle Assessment collaborate in calculating the environmental impact. Impatto Zero® works with Parks and Reserves to reforest and safeguard territories. Bios, an agency that has been recognized by the European Union, certifies the entire Impatto Zero® chain of activities.
